What Will I Learn?
This course teaches selection of wild plants, taxonomic verification, and mapping of current ranges using occurrence records, ecoregions, and altitude data. It covers linking distributions to climate, soils, topography, disturbances, and biotic factors, interpreting past shifts and future projections, and compiling evidence-based phytogeographic reports from varied sources.
